Warning Signs You Need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al

Catching washing machine overflow water removal problems early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age to your home. Look out for these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ign that water has damaged your walls, floors, or belongings. Don’t ignore the smell it’s a warning sign that water has caused significant dam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

If your flooring is warped, buckled, or discolored, it could be a sign that water has seeped into the subfloor. Act qu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Visible Water Stains

If you notice water stains on your walls, ceilings, or floors, it’s a clear sign that water has damaged your property. Don’t delay call us immediately to schedule an appointment.

Unpleasant Odors from Appliances

If your washing machine, dishwasher, or other appliances are emitting unpleasant odors, it could be a sign that water has damaged the internal parts. Don’t ignore the smell it’s a warning sign that you need professional help.

Water Damage on Walls or Ceilings

If you notice water damage on your walls or ceilings, it’s a clear sign that water has caused significant damage. Act qu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Discoloration or Warping of Wood

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ill Yes No DIY methods are effective for small spills, and you can save money by doing it yourself.
Washing machine overflow with standing water No Yes Standing water needs professional equipment and expertise to extract safely and prevent further damage.
Water damage to walls or ceilings No Yes Water damage to walls or ceilings needs specialized equipment and techniques to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ment.
Musty odors or mold growth No Yes Mold growth needs professional equipment and expertise to remove safely and prevent further growth.
Warped or buckled flooring No Yes Warped or buckled flooring need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ment.
Water damage to electrical parts No Yes Water damage to electrical parts needs professional expertise to prevent electrical shock and ensure a safe environment.
